With this chapter starts the third part of our book, dedicated to

the thorough presentation of QOMB, a wireless network emula-

tion testbed to the development of which we participated and

still contribute actively [15]. QOMB is a relatively new network

emulation tool, hence not so widely known in the research

community. Nevertheless, the issues that we encountered during its

development also apply to other network emulators. We therefore

think that reporting our hands-on experience with QOMB will help

our readers in two possible ways:

• Those involved in developing network emulators should find helpful hints by reading the description of the components

of QOMB, and their integration (Chapter 10, Chapter 11, and

Chapter 12).
